Wooden blocks are such a versatile play item. Covering different sized blocks in clear contact (sticky side facing out) and providing various decorative pieces allows children to transform wooden blocks into all sorts of imaginative creations.
We design activities to suit different learning styles, for example if you have a child that is a kinesthetic learner and prefers to “learn on the go” they might enjoy one of the games featured here that involves physical activity. We created some bubble wrap “tiles” to prepare a playful learning game to suit a toddler and four year old. For the toddler, coloured shapes covered in bubble wrap were placed on the floor and for the older child some letter and word tiles were prepared. We have created several different enjoyable games to play with bubble wrap tiles that are guaranteed to have your child laughing and learning at the same time. Other games we have created include making up gigantic game boards using masking tape.

These pop up pieces have been created from cardboard. Combining some favourite toys and figurines with them can lead to many hours of imaginative play.

We can show you how to make a stunning backdrop for a shadow box using crayons and watercolours. The beauty of this artwork, like all of our ideas, is that this creation can be modified and the stunning result is easy for young children to achieve. The particular shadow box featured here has been enjoyed by a fairy loving girl – many stories have been told about fairies and their adventures. Using this particular technique you could create an underwater land, or make a scene for another planet. The possibilities are endless and only limited by your imagination.
Adding a basket of props (such as shells, felt, paper doilies, feathers etc) inspires creative play when building with blocks.
